Complete Tax Breakdown

Detailed line-by-line tax calculation for a Marketing Managers earning $130,690 in Montana (single filer, standard deduction).

Tax Component Annual Amount Effective Rate
Gross Salary (Median) $130,690
Federal Income Tax -$20,904 16.0%
Montana State Income Tax -$7,464 5.7%
Social Security (OASDI) -$8,102 6.2%
Medicare -$1,895 1.5%
Total Taxes -$38,366 29.4%
Take-Home Pay $92,323 70.6%

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the take-home pay for a Marketing Managers in Montana?

A Marketing Managers in Montana earning a median salary of $130,690 will take home approximately $92,323 per year after federal income tax ($20,904), state income tax ($7,464), and FICA ($9,997). That is $7,693 per month or $3,550 per bi-weekly paycheck.

What is the effective tax rate for a Marketing Managers in Montana?

The effective total tax rate for a Marketing Managers in Montana is 29.4%, broken down as: federal income tax 16.0%, Montana state tax 5.7%, and FICA (Social Security + Medicare) 7.6%. This assumes a single filer with the standard deduction for 2024.

How much state tax does a Marketing Managers pay in Montana?

Montana has a progressive (up to 5.9%). On a Marketing Managers's median salary of $130,690, the state income tax amounts to $7,464 per year, which is an effective state rate of 5.7%.

What is the monthly take-home pay for a Marketing Managers in Montana?

After all taxes, a Marketing Managers in Montana takes home approximately $7,693 per month, or about $44.39 per hour (based on a standard 2,080-hour work year). These figures assume a single filer, standard deduction, and no additional pre-tax deductions.

How is Marketing Managers take-home pay in Montana calculated?

We start with the 2024 BLS median salary of $130,690 for Marketing Managers in Montana, then subtract: federal income tax using 2024 IRS brackets ($14,600 standard deduction), Montana state income tax (progressive (up to 5.9%)), Social Security (6.2% up to $168,600), and Medicare (1.45%). The result — $92,323/yr — does not include local taxes, pre-tax deductions (401k, HSA), or tax credits.

Tax Calculation Assumptions

This estimate assumes a single filer using the 2024 standard deduction ($14,600), with W-2 employment income only. It does not account for: itemized deductions, tax credits (e.g. earned income credit, child tax credit), local/city taxes, pre-tax contributions (401k, HSA, FSA), self-employment tax, or additional income sources. Actual take-home pay may differ. Consult a tax professional for personalized advice.
